  6. T

    Pet turkey questions

    Turkeys die very easy when are chicks. Suggest you get five. Then will maybe have three left if lucky. Need 30 percent protein. Look for game bird feed 20 lbs for 20 to 30 dollars. Order a few chicks same age. Turkeys are slow. They need chicks to help them learn how to eat. Get two at least...
